Skip to content

tbela99/progressbar

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

11 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

ProgressBar

Javascript progressbar

Demo

Screenshot

How to use

The progressbar can use either colors or background image.

object providing methods to control field upload.

Syntax

var progressbar = new ProgressBar({container: 'element'});

(boolean) indicates if the browser handle file upload via XMLHTTPRequest.

Arguments:

  1. options - (object)
Options:
  • container - (mixed) progressbar container.
  • width - (int, optional) progressbar width. default to the container width.
  • value - (number, optional) initial value of the progressbar. value is always between 0 and 1 (100%). default to 0.
  • text - (string, optional) progressbar text.
  • color - (string, optional) progressbar color.
  • fillColor - (string, optional) progressbar fill color.
  • backgroundImage - (string, optional) background image used to fill the progressbar. this parameter will shadow the fillColor parameter.
Events:
onChange

Fired after the value is changed.

Arguments:
  • value - (number) the current value
  • progressbar - (object) this progressbar
onComplete

Fired after the value has been set to 1.

Arguments:
  • progressbar - (object) this progressbar
setText

set the text in the progressbar

Arguments:
  • text - (string)
setValue

set the progressbar value. the value is a number between 0 and 1.

Arguments:
  • value - (number)
getValue

return the progressbar value.

About

Progressbar that use either an image or a color to show progression

Resources

Stars

Watchers

Forks

Packages

No packages published